Memorandum for Record: Renaissance
To:
Purpose: To describe the Sunnyvale Middle
School Renaissance Program.
1. The Sunnyvale Middle School Renaissance
Program recognizes each trimester students who demonstrate superior Life Long
Learning skills in the following areas:
a. Classroom
Participation
b. Involvement
in Community Activities
c. Academic
achievement
2. Classroom participation includes
meeting the expectations of students for behavior in class at all times and the
timely completion of all assigned work.
3. Involvement in Community Activities
consists of significant participation.
a. The
expectation for significant participation reflects a regular commitment of time
spent participating in an activity that is in addition to normal classroom
requirements. For example, tutoring a
student at a homework club would qualify, while mere attendance at a homework
club is not sufficient.
b. Participation
can be in any of any of the following:
1. A school sponsored extra-curricular
activity such as a club or after-school sports
2. A Community sponsored activity such as
sports teams or service organizations
3. Volunteer service through a Community
organization. Volunteer service implies
that you were not compensated for your service.
For example, baby sitting at your families religious services is
acceptable, however; baby sitting at home does not meet the expectation.
4. Academic Achievement is
demonstrated in one of two ways:
a. For
the First Trimester Achievement on the previous years’ CST will be used.
1. GOLD=Advanced (Level 5) in both ELA and
MATH.
2. SILVER=At least Proficient (Level 4) in
ELA and MATH
3. BRONZE=At least Basic (Level 3) in ELA
and MATH
b. For
the Second and Third Trimester current achievement marks will be used.
1. GOLD=3.6 to 4.0.
2. SILVER=2.6 to 3.5
3. BRONZE=2.5 to 2.0
4. No “D’s” or “F’s”

5. Recognition. Students who turn in on time during
Renaissance Stamping Week their application form (sample attached) will have
their SMS identification card stamped either GOLD, SILVER, or BRONZE. All late applications will be stamped at the
BRONZE level. It is the student’s
responsibility to submit the application on time and maintain their SMS
identification card. Students at each
level during a trimester will be entitled to the following:
a. GOLD:
1. Attendance at Assembly (with a pizza
snack and beverage)
2. Attendance at a Pizza lunch
3. Attendance at a healthy dessert lunch
4. Five front of the line passes.
b. SILVER:
1. Attendance at Assembly (with a pizza
snack and beverage)
2. Attendance at a healthy dessert lunch
3. Three front of the line passes.
c. BRONZE:
1. Attendance at Assembly (with a pizza
snack and beverage)
2. One front of the line pass.
6. This
program is conducted by the Sunnyvale Middle School Associated Student Body
Student Council with the support of the SMS Parent, Teacher, and Student Association.
